Comprehending Roof Covering Moss and Its Growth Conditions
Moss can be a sneaky trespasser on your roof covering, growing in wet, shaded environments. If your home's roofing system doesn't obtain enough sunshine, moss can take origin and spread, swiftly ending up being a problem. You may discover it growing in locations where leaves or particles accumulate, capturing wetness and creating an optimal environment for moss development.
To stop moss from attacking your roofing system, it's crucial to maintain rain gutters clean and keep correct water drainage. Trim looming branches to permit sunshine to reach your roof, drying dampness and decreasing moss growth problems. Routine upkeep checks can aid you spot early indications of moss, enabling you to resolve it prior to it ends up being a bigger issue.
Understanding the variables that contribute to roof covering moss growth permits you to take proactive steps, ensuring your roof covering continues to be in great condition and prolonging its life-span. Maintain your roof covering clean and completely dry, and it'll thank you later.
The Threats Related To Roofing Moss
While it might seem harmless, allowing moss to flourish on your roof covering can cause substantial dangers for your home. Moss holds wetness against your roofing products, which can produce an ideal breeding place for rot and degeneration. Gradually, this dampness can endanger your tiles, resulting in leakages and extensive water damage inside your home.
In addition, moss can raise shingles, causing them to come to be dislodged or split, which additionally subjects your roofing system to the components. The buildup of moss likewise includes weight to your roof, potentially straining its architectural stability.
Neglecting these concerns can cause expensive repairs and even premature roof substitute. By acting to eliminate moss, you not only protect your roof covering however also expand its life-span. Effective Approaches for Roof Moss Elimination
When dealing with moss on your roofing system, selecting the appropriate removal approach is crucial for both efficiency and security. One preferred method is making use of a blend of water and vinegar, which you can spray straight onto the moss. Let it rest for around 20 mins prior to carefully scrubbing with a soft-bristle brush. This approach is eco-friendly and stops damage to your shingles.
Additionally, you can opt for industrial moss eliminators, specifically designed for roofs. Bonuses These items frequently include chemicals that effectively eliminate moss without harming your shingles. Constantly follow the supplier's guidelines for the finest results.
If the moss is substantial, think about working with an expert service. They have specialized devices and know-how to securely eliminate moss without risking injury or damage. Whichever method you select, ensure you're furnished with security gear and take essential precautions while dealing with your roof.
Safety Nets to Avoid Roofing Moss Growth

Think about mounting zinc or copper strips along the ridge of your roof. Rain cleaning over these metals can hinder moss development. Frequently evaluate your roof covering for any indications of moss or debris accumulation, dealing with problems without delay.
Last but not least, pick roofing products carefully. Some products are much more immune to moss than others, so do your research study before making a decision. By taking these precautionary measures, you'll significantly lower the possibilities of moss invading your roofing system, ensuring its longevity and maintaining your home's general health.

How Often Should I Evaluate My Roof for Moss?
You need to inspect your roof covering for moss at the very least two times a year, ideally in springtime and autumn. Normal checks assist you catch any kind of growth early, protecting against damages and ensuring your roof covering remains in good condition.
Can Moss Damage Various Other Parts of My Home?
Yes, moss can damage other components of your home. It retains wetness, which may lead to timber rot, mold and mildew growth, and jeopardized insulation. Routine inspections assist you stop these issues and preserve your home's integrity.
What Are the most effective Seasons for Moss Elimination?
The most effective seasons for moss removal are normally late springtime and very early autumn. During these times, temperature levels are modest, and dampness degrees are well balanced, making it less complicated for you to successfully clear moss from your roof.
Does Roofing System Moss Removal Require Special Licenses?
You commonly do not need special licenses for roof covering moss removal, however it's important to inspect regional guidelines. Constantly make sure you're adhering to safety and security guidelines and using proper approaches to protect your home and the setting.
Is Moss Removal Covered by Homeowners Insurance Policy?
Moss elimination typically isn't covered by homeowners insurance policy, as it's taken into consideration regular upkeep. You should examine your policy for specifics. It's constantly an excellent concept to clarify coverage details with your insurance coverage representative.
